About the Role: As a HR Consultant, you will drive people operations for designated small business clients on behalf of Gusto. In this role, you will excel in dynamic and challenging environments, applying your passion for developing and refining processes and practices. You will be skilled at leveraging cutting edge technology and systems to drive efficiency within the organization you support. About the Team: Gusto’s is growing and scaling! As our business scales and becomes more complex, we’re helping our clients in new and different ways to help them find success. Join our team to be part of our journey to support our clients HR needs. Here’s what you’ll do day-to-day: Lead the organizations you support to achieve People objectives, including attracting, hiring and onboarding great talent, developing and retaining staff, and achieving goals around helping companies stay compliant. Influence business and talent initiatives that support short and long-term business goals, including driving practices that enable high performance and operational excellence. Initiate and maintain effective communications with leadership and employees; provide coaching and guidance on matters related to performance management, offer feedback on style and behaviors to improve employee productivity and engagement. Engage in strategic workforce planning by assessing organizational capabilities; identify competency and talent gaps, ensure development of people resources; and introduce succession planning. Identify and translate current and future business needs into a comprehensive People Plans. Provide organizational development support through interventions such as organization design, development solutions, leadership coaching, and proactive change management. Serve as the primary point of contact for assigned clients. Process and maintain client HR data, including employee onboarding and offboarding, help administer payroll, benefits, and other HR functions, and ensure clients stay up-to-date on HR regulations and compliance requirements. Here’s what we're looking for: 4-8 years of HR experience as a People Operations Specialist and/or HR Generalist across various industries and scales. Excellent communication skills, capable of clearly and concisely conveying information to employees at all levels. Strong proficiency with cutting edge technology across the workplace and high level of comfort in quickly adopting new technology. Proficiency with HR software, Google Suite, and modern productivity tools (Slack, Asana, Zoom, etc.) Ability to manage multiple stakeholders and competing priorities, demonstrating urgency and adaptability to changing business needs. Significant experience with workforce analytics, using data and reporting to drive strategic decisions. Demonstrated agility and ability to thrive in ambiguous, fast-paced, and dynamic environments. Ability to maintain confidentiality and handle issues ethically and with integrity. A perpetual learner who strives for excellence while remaining laser focused on our mission to help clients thrive Our cash compensation amount for this role is between $98,000 - $115,000/year in Denver and most other major cities, and between $119,000 - $140,000/year for New York & San Francisco. Final offer amounts are determined by multiple factors including candidate location, experience and expertise and may vary from the amounts listed above. Gusto has physical office spaces in Denver, San Francisco, and New York City. Employees who are based in those locations will be expected to work from the office on designated days approximately 2-3 days per week (or more depending on role).
